Piper PA-30 N8555Y
24 February 1970 · Wappinger Fals, New York, United States · No injuries
Summary
On 24 February 1970 at about 11:15 local time, a Piper PA-30 registered N8555Y, operated by Trans Sky Airw, was involved in an accident during the landing phase of flight near Wappinger Fals, New York, United States. One person was on board and nobody was injured. The aircraft was substantially damaged. No probable cause statement is available for this record.

Read the full NTSB narrative
R LDG GR CASTERING BACK AND FORTH ON LDG DUE TO MISSING NUT/COTTER KEY IN TORQUE LINK SCISSOR.
Quoted verbatim from the NTSB record.
